Introduction to Vertical Multistage Centrifugal Pumps

The Basics of Vertical Multistage Centrifugal Pumps

Vertical multistage centrifugal pumps are designed to move water and other fluids through a vertical structure with multiple impellers, each stage increasing the pressure of the fluid as it moves upwards. These pumps are known for their efficiency and ability to generate high pressures.

Importance in Modern Industry

Vertical multistage centrifugal pumps are essential in various applications, including water supply, industrial pressure boosting, irrigation systems, and HVAC. Their vertical design makes them particularly suitable for installations with limited ground space.

Design and Operation

Understanding the Multistage Mechanism

A vertical multistage centrifugal pump consists of several impellers arranged above each other, each stage contributing to the total pressure output. The vertical design allows for a compact footprint and a balanced axial thrust.

Components of Vertical Multistage Pumps

Key components include the shaft, impellers, diffusers, and a casing that houses the stages. Materials used for these parts vary depending on the application and can range from cast iron to stainless steel for corrosion resistance.

Advantages of Vertical Multistage Centrifugal Pumps

High-Pressure Output

One of the primary benefits of vertical multistage centrifugal pumps is their ability to achieve high pressures, making them ideal for systems that require fluid to be transported over long distances or to great heights.

Energy Efficiency

The multistage design allows these pumps to operate more efficiently than single-stage pumps when generating high pressures, leading to energy savings and reduced operational costs.

Space-Saving Vertical Configuration

The vertical configuration of these pumps saves valuable floor space, which is particularly advantageous in crowded industrial environments or urban water supply systems.

Applications and Industries

Water Treatment and Distribution

Vertical multistage centrifugal pumps are widely used in water treatment plants and distribution systems, where they ensure consistent water pressure across extensive networks.

Industrial Processes

In industrial settings, these pumps facilitate processes that require precise pressure control, such as in the chemical, pharmaceutical, and food and beverage industries.

Building Services

High-rise buildings benefit from vertical multistage centrifugal pumps for water supply and fire-fighting systems, where maintaining pressure at elevated levels is crucial.

Selection Criteria for Vertical Multistage Centrifugal Pumps

Assessing Flow Rate and Pressure Requirements

When selecting a pump, it’s essential to consider the required flow rate and pressure to ensure the pump can handle the system’s demands.

Material Compatibility

The materials used in the pump’s construction must be compatible with the fluid being pumped to prevent corrosion and wear.

Energy Considerations

Energy efficiency is a critical factor, as pumps can be a significant contributor to operational costs. Choosing a pump with a high-efficiency motor can lead to long-term savings.

Maintenance and Lifespan

Routine Inspection and Maintenance

Regular maintenance is vital for ensuring the longevity and reliability of vertical multistage centrifugal pumps. This includes checking seals, bearings, and impellers for wear.

Extending Pump Lifespan

Proper installation, along with adherence to maintenance schedules, can significantly extend the lifespan of these pumps, reducing the need for replacements and repairs.
